Biomass materials such as wood chips, branches, and bark are larger in particle size, chip diameter, and length than wood chips. Smooth feeding and sufficient mass and heat exchange per unit time must be ensured to ensure the drying effect of the finished product. The drum of Zhengzhou Jiutian wood chip dryer is equipped with lifting plates and guide plates at different angles and spacings. This structure can ensure that the materials to be dried move along the movement direction of the guide plates under the action of gravity and maintain sufficient space in the drum. The residence time and sufficient dispersion allow the material in the barrel to fully exchange heat with the hot air flow from the combustion chamber. It eliminates the shortcomings of small heat exchange area and low evaporation intensity per unit volume caused by wind tunnels that often occur in conventional drying equipment. The special structure makes the inner and middle cylinders surrounded by the outer cylinder to form a self-insulation system. The heat emitted from the surface of the inner and middle cylinders participates in the materials in the outer cylinder, and the outer cylinder is at the low temperature end of the hot air flow. Therefore, the heat dissipation area and energy loss of the cylinder are significantly reduced. The energy-saving three-cylinder dryer can make full use of waste heat, reduce heat loss, increase the exchange area, and greatly increase the evaporation intensity per unit volume of the dryer, thereby effectively increasing the heat energy utilization rate, reducing energy consumption, and meeting the needs of wood chips, branches, bark material drying needs.
